    Hi,

    I'm currently in school, working toward my AZ and will be starting an internship in October. Afterword, I'm looking to do some long-haul team driving with my boyfriend (already licenced), and our dog.

    Can anyone share their experiences/opinions on bringing a pet? Which companies allow this?

    Thanks for any advice,
    Steph

    TransX allows pets in the trucks. Even allows them in terminals. They just don't let them run free.

    Many times in our Winnipeg terminal someone has their dog with them. One of our guys had a cat the other day.

    Someone had a chihuahua/pit bull cross. Cutest little bugger!! How it happened is beyond me, though.

    And we do run teams.

    Prime inc is pet friendly they even built a fenced kennel at the terminal in Springfield to let your dog run a bit
